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,250 in Phuket versus $708 in Wenling.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,284 in Phuket versus $1,129 in Wenling.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,317 in Phuket versus $1,551 in Wenling.

Living in Phuket is roughly 77% more expensive than in Wenling,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both cities sit below the global median: Phuket 6% lower, Wenling 47% lower.
